    I've used this shop for over 10 years, brought them 5 vehicles, and have referred others because of…read moremy past experiences. Unfortunately, this recent situation did not reflect the level of service I had come to expect. I had a small tint defect that I noticed from day one after installation, but did not address with the business. Over a year later, it appeared to delaminate, which can occur when a contaminant trapped between the glass and adhesive creates a localized adhesion failure that worsens over time through heat cycles, thermal expansion, and adhesive stress. The defect was a circular mark with a visible halo around it, which is more consistent with a localized adhesion issue than a typical surface abrasion. When I brought it in, multiple staff members repeatedly insisted it was "physical damage," including the explanation that a seatbelt could create a perfectly circular mark in the middle of the window. That explanation did not align with the defect I was seeing, especially since seatbelt contact would more typically leave an elongated scuff, arc, or irregular abrasion rather than a clean, centered circle with a halo. It was frustrating to feel like my concern was dismissed rather than properly evaluated. To their credit, they ultimately agreed to redo the tint at no charge. However, during the replacement process I noticed another contaminant before leaving and had to point it out for correction. After the second attempt, there was still a visible dust speck in the upper corner, which I was told was "acceptable" as long as it was not in the main line of sight. I appreciate that they honored the redo, but the overall experience was disappointing. The repeated insistence that the original issue was my fault, the need for multiple attempts, and the remaining defect did not match the quality and attention to detail I had experienced from them over the years. I hope this feedback is taken constructively, because I truly valued this business and would like to see them maintain the standard that originally earned my trust.
